Gruppo Mastrotto produces cow hides and calf skins
for footwear, upholstery, leather goods, automotive and garments.
We have many and different types of leather and production process,
in order to respond to the market’s demands.
The main categories are:
Grain (the top layer of the leather, opposed to the .esh side) which
is divided in:
Full grain (leather which has not been treated at all – the
“.ore” is still visible and uncovered and is completely
.nished with aniline).
Corrected grain (leather from which the grain layer has been partially
removed by buf.ng and upon whose a new surface has been built by various
.nishes);
Nubuck (leather buffed on the grain side to give a velvety surface);
Split (product obtained from the inferior layer of leather by splitting
it) which is divided in:
- Suede (leather whose surface has been .nished to give it a velvety
effect);
- Pigmented split (leather .nished with pigment);
- PU Split MASPEL(tm) or Bay Cast (leather with a thin polyurethane .lm (PU), entirely
.nished with water);
- Finished split (.nished leather which contains a little quantity of
pigment and aniline).
